An Advanced Certificate in Conflict Resolution equips professionals with advanced skills and knowledge to effectively manage and resolve conflicts in diverse settings. This specialized program focuses on developing expertise in conflict analysis, negotiation, mediation, and facilitation techniques.
Learning outcomes for this certificate include mastering advanced negotiation strategies, applying mediation techniques in complex situations, understanding diverse conflict styles and cultural nuances, and developing effective communication skills for conflict resolution. Graduates will be proficient in designing and implementing conflict prevention programs.
The duration of the Advanced Certificate in Conflict Resolution typically ranges from several months to a year, depending on the program's intensity and structure. Some programs offer flexible online learning options, while others require on-campus attendance. A blended learning approach is also common.
